MET Bhujbal Knowledge City, Nashik, offers a 4-year Bachelor of Technology in Computer Science and Design affiliated with Savitribai Phule Pune University with an intake of 120 students. Admission is through Maharashtra DTE’s CAP process via MHT CET (PCM) scores. Total course fees stand at INR 7,40,593. The programme integrates computer science fundamentals with design thinking, UI/UX, and human-computer interaction, preparing graduates for roles in product design, front-end development, and digital media.

Eligibility Criteria

  • 10+2 or equivalent with Physics and Mathematics as compulsory subjects along with Chemistry, Computer Science, or Electronics as an additional subject
  • Minimum 45% aggregate marks in 10+2 qualifying examination, with 40% for SC/ST and other reserved categories under Maharashtra quota
  • Valid MHT CET 2026 (PCM group) score is required for merit rank in Maharashtra CAP. JEE Main scores may be considered for All India quota seats

Admission Process

  • Appear for MHT CET (PCM group) as the qualifying entrance examination for B.Tech programmes in Maharashtra
  • Register on cetcell.mahacet.org for the BE/B.Tech CAP process and upload required documents
  • Check the provisional and final merit lists released on July 15 and July 20, 2026
  • Fill college and branch preference form on the CAP portal choosing MET BKC’s Computer Science and Design branch
  • Accept seat allotment through the CAP Round and report to MET BKC with original documents for verification
  • Pay the programme fees to confirm admission and complete enrolment formalities at the institute

Ques. What is B.Tech Computer Science and Design and how does it differ from BE Computer Engineering?

Ans. B.Tech Computer Science and Design combines core computer science subjects including algorithms, databases, and programming with design disciplines such as UI/UX design, human-computer interaction, and digital media. BE Computer Engineering has a deeper focus on systems-level computing, computer architecture, and software engineering. CSD is suited for students who want to work at the intersection of technology and creative design.

Ques. What career roles are available after B.Tech Computer Science and Design from MET BKC?

Ans. Graduates can pursue roles as UI/UX designers, product designers, front-end developers, interaction designers, digital media specialists, and visual communication professionals. Technology companies, design studios, advertising agencies, and product firms hire graduates in design-focused roles. Higher studies in Design, HCI, or an MBA in marketing or media management are also options.
